Mexican Tinga Chicken Tostadas with Avocado

Smoky chipotle-tomato chicken, black beans and crunchy toppings turn simple tostadas into a fast dinner.

  • 35 min
  • Serves 4

Ingredients

  • 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 yellow onion, thinly sliced
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 can fire-roasted diced tomatoes
  • 2 canned chipotle chiles in adobo, chopped
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p ground cumin
  • 1 can black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 8 crisp corn tostadas
  • 1 avocado, sliced
  • 2 cups shredded lettuce
  • 1/2 cup crumbled queso fresco and 1/2 cup pickled red onions
  • Kosher salt and lime wedges

Steps

  1. Cover chicken with water in a small saucepan, bring to a gentle simmer, and cook until it reaches 165°F. Rest 5 minutes, then shred.
  2. Heat oil in a skillet and cook onion until soft. Add garlic, tomatoes, chipotles, oregano and cumin; simmer until thickened.
  3. Stir shredded chicken into the sauce and cook 5 minutes, seasoning with salt.
  4. Warm beans in a small pan and lightly mash them with a pinch of salt.
  5. Spread each tostada with beans, then add tinga, lettuce, avocado, queso fresco, pickled onion and a squeeze of lime.

Allergen note: Contains dairy if using queso fresco; check adobo sauce and tostadas for allergens.
